Transaction 51f72a912a7c67c8da4df96b4039b05fe45cec344a05bfe1008f37a23de2a5d4

1 Input
2 Outputs
  • 51f72a912a7c67c8da4df96b4039b05fe45cec344a05bfe1008f37a23de2a5d4:0
  • value  5088000
    address  3MrWFgPNPFFdtikYZDTZNr7kZTSwZ7ZuUB
  • 51f72a912a7c67c8da4df96b4039b05fe45cec344a05bfe1008f37a23de2a5d4:1
  • value  3080188
    address  bc1q5pypweyal0rxcue6772wwyucm8uugv2mczsrz4